Bearpit Tournament

A classic “king-of-the-hill” style tournament. After each bout the winning fighter will stay on the field and fight the next combattant. The fighter who wins the most fights at the end of the time limit wins the tournament. Double kills result in both fighters losing.

Two-Hander Tournament

Fighters may only use two-handed weapons in this tournament. Rigid hand protection is required for all fighters. Some loaner equipment will be available. Tourney format will depend on the number of combattants.

Melee Games

Fighters will take part in various melee scenarios. The specific scenarios will depend on the number of fighters. These may include capture the flag, escort the VIP, last person standing, etc.

Rose Tournament

The Calontir Order of the Rose invite all Roses to the Order of the Rose Rattan and Cut & Thrust tournament. All Roses are encouraged to invite: 1 Rattan Combatant and 1 Cut and Thrust Combatant (ranked or unranked, your choice) Each tournament will have a separate list tree, with the Rattan and Cut & Thrust fights interspersed. These are both double elimination tournaments. All bouts best 2 out of 3.

Youth Sponsor Tourney

All fighters will be sponsored by a youth. Standard double elim, hopefully alternating C&T and Rattan rounds. Sponsored by Albrecht von Trier

Butcher Tourney

Can you slice off the right cut of meat? At the beginning of each round, fighters will draw lots to determine a secret target. They only lose if they are struck in that location. The tournament will follow a round-robin or bear-pit style depending on numbers.
